WOODIN is an exciting new mass timber office building planned for the suburban Waterloo office market. This three-storey multi-tenant office development will meet modern commercial office standards while pushing the limits of wood construction. 

 

Featuring high ceilings, open floor plates, and expansive glazing, this mass timber office building aims to deliver the aesthetic qualities desired by Class A office tenants using innovative wood products and systems. Laminated timber beams and columns and long span cross-laminated timber floors will work together to achieve optimal efficiency, flexibility, and beauty. This mass timber building will also incorporate a multi-storey living wall biofilter system that will clean the air naturally and bring nature indoors. 

 

This project has received support and funding from Natural Resource Canada’s Green Construction through Wood Program.

Why Mass Timber?

Safe & Strong

Wood buildings meet and in some cases, exceed, the safety requirements of the building code. Mass timber also performs well in fire. The large, solid compressed masses of wood are actually difficult to ignite.

Faster Build

Building with wood is efficient, often completed faster than other systems, and can be done year-round in almost any climate. It is readily available and tends to be delivered faster than other materials.

Biophilic Benefits

Research confirms that being exposed to natural materials can have positive biophilic effects giving us a sense of well-being. The exposed wood is warmer than other materials and more aesthetically pleasing.

Sustainable

Wood is a natural, renewable, and sustainable material, with a lighter carbon footprint than steel or concrete. Wood is also the only renewable building material that is harvested from responsibly managed forests.

Maximizing wood use in both residential and commercial construction could remove an estimated 21 million tons of C02 from the atmosphere annually – equal to taking 4.4 million cars off the road.

Wood for Good

In a region renowned for innovation and technology, the WOODIN building becomes a testing ground for low-rise wood construction in Canada, and joins other projects that use wood products as a powerful tool to mitigate global climate change.

Nature Indoors and Out

Living walls deliver a number of unique and significant benefits. They include improved air quality and work environments and increased energy efficiency. A living wall combines science and art to deliver clean air in an aesthetically pleasing and sustainable manner.
